怎么在excel数字前加10

怎么在excel数字前加10

在Excel数字前加10的方法有多种:使用公式、通过格式设置、利用宏等。 其中,使用公式是最简单而直接的方法。通过在目标单元格中输入适当的公式,可以在原有数字前加上10。以下是具体方法的详细描述。

一、使用公式

使用公式是最常用且简单的方式之一。可以在目标单元格中输入公式来实现这一目的。以下是具体步骤:

  1. 在需要加10的数字旁边的单元格中输入公式。例如,如果要在A1单元格的数字前加10,在B1单元格中输入公式 =10 + A1
  2. 按下回车键,B1单元格中将显示A1单元格中的数字加上10的结果。
  3. 如果有多行数据,可以将公式向下拖动填充。

示例:

假设A列有一组数字,B列需要显示每个数字加10后的结果。

  • 在B1单元格中输入 =10 + A1
  • 按回车键后,B1单元格将显示结果。
  • 将B1单元格的公式向下拖动至其他单元格,即可完成批量处理。

二、使用文本函数

有时候我们需要在数字前面加上10并且保留它们的字符串格式。可以使用Excel的文本函数来实现这一目的。

1、使用CONCATENATE函数

CONCATENATE函数可以将多个字符串连接在一起。通过该函数,可以在数字前面加上10。

  1. 在目标单元格中输入公式,例如 =CONCATENATE("10", A1)
  2. 按下回车键,目标单元格中将显示10和A1单元格中数字的组合。
  3. 向下拖动填充公式,处理整列数据。

2、使用“&”运算符

“&”运算符也可以用于将多个字符串连接在一起,与CONCATENATE函数类似。

  1. 在目标单元格中输入公式,例如 ="10" & A1
  2. 按下回车键,目标单元格中将显示10和A1单元格中数字的组合。
  3. 向下拖动填充公式,处理整列数据。

三、使用自定义格式

如果你希望在数字前面加上10,但不改变原有数据,可以使用Excel的自定义格式功能。

  1. 选择需要加10的单元格区域。
  2. 右键点击选择区域,选择“设置单元格格式”。
  3. 在“数字”选项卡中选择“自定义”。
  4. 在“类型”框中输入 10# 或者其他合适的自定义格式。
  5. 点击“确定”,所选单元格将显示10在数字前面。

四、使用宏

对于需要频繁处理大批量数据的情况,可以使用VBA宏来自动化这一过程。以下是一个简单的VBA宏示例:

  1. 按下Alt + F11打开VBA编辑器。
  2. 插入一个新模块,并输入以下代码:

Sub AddTenToNumbers()

Dim rng As Range

Dim cell As Range

' 选择需要加10的单元格范围

Set rng = Selection

' 遍历每个单元格并加10

For Each cell In rng

If IsNumeric(cell.Value) Then

cell.Value = 10 + cell.Value

End If

Next cell

End Sub

  1. 关闭VBA编辑器,返回Excel。
  2. 选择需要加10的单元格区域。
  3. 按下Alt + F8,选择并运行AddTenToNumbers宏。

五、使用Power Query

对于需要处理大量数据和复杂数据转换的情况,可以使用Power Query工具。

  1. 选择“数据”选项卡,点击“从表/范围”导入数据到Power Query编辑器。
  2. 在Power Query编辑器中,选择需要加10的列。
  3. 使用“添加列”选项卡中的“自定义列”功能,输入公式 = 10 + [列名]
  4. 确认并关闭Power Query编辑器,数据将返回Excel工作表。

六、使用数组公式

对于需要一次性处理整个数据范围的情况,可以使用数组公式。

  1. 选择目标单元格区域。
  2. 输入公式 =10 + A1:A10,按下Ctrl + Shift + Enter键。
  3. 目标单元格区域将显示加10后的结果。

以上介绍了多种在Excel数字前加10的方法,包括使用公式、文本函数、自定义格式、宏、Power Query和数组公式。每种方法都有其适用的场景和优缺点,用户可以根据实际需求选择合适的方法。通过这些方法,可以轻松实现数据的批量处理和自动化,提高工作效率。

相关问答FAQs:

1. 如何在Excel中给数字前加上一个固定的值?
在Excel中,您可以使用公式来给数字前添加一个固定的值。例如,如果您要在数字前加上10,可以使用以下公式:=10+A1,其中A1是您想要添加前缀的数字所在的单元格。

2. 如何在Excel中批量给数字前加上相同的值?
如果您需要在Excel中批量给一列数字前添加相同的值,可以使用填充功能来实现。首先,在一个单元格中输入您想要添加的前缀,然后选中该单元格并将鼠标悬停在右下角,直到鼠标变成黑色十字形。然后,点击并拖动鼠标,将前缀填充到您想要添加的数字范围。

3. 如何在Excel中给数字前添加不同的值?
如果您需要在Excel中给不同的数字前添加不同的值,可以使用公式和绝对引用来实现。例如,如果您想给A列中的每个数字前添加不同的值,可以在B列中输入公式=B1+A1,然后将该公式拖动到其他单元格。这样,每个数字前都会添加与其对应的前缀值。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4303346

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部